Local Comic Looking for National Chance
A Fowlerville man hopes to get a shot at national exposure with an appearance on NBC's "Last Comic Standing."

Comedy fans are being invited to gather in Howell tonight to cheer on John Heffron, who is one of three finalists competing on NBC's “Last Comic Standing.''
Heffron grew up in the South Lyon area in Oakland County. His family now lives in Fowlerville.
Heffron's father says his son has always been a comedian. He says John entertained customers with jokes over the PA system at the grocery store where he worked as a teenager.
“Last Comic Standing'' is like “American Idol,” without all the singing.
Heffron will match jokes with Alonzo Bodden and Gary Gulman, then viewers nationwide will vote by phone or Internet for their favorite.
The winner will be crowned Thursday night.
